Stuart Hall School for Boys was founded in 1984 by William M. Gallop in response to the long-time need for a Catholic boys' school in the New Orleans area at the preschool and elementary levels. The school is named for Janet Erskine Stuart, a well-known religious of the Sacred Heart who was an English educator living at the turn of the century. Janet Erskine Stuart's writings and philosophy transcend the limits of time and represent the basis upon which the school was founded.
The school is autonomous in setting its curriculum and determining its future. The school is affiliated with the Archdiocese of New Orleans, is accredited by the Independent School Association of the Southwest (ISAS), and is a member of the National Association of Independent Schools (NAIS).
